We are in a position that both sides have needs:
1. The team needs value for letting one of the top Centers in the market leave.
2. Jack "needs" really wants, out.
The best way to get that:
1. Jack to get healthy.
2. Jack to show he can be professional.
3. Team can demonstrate to player they will work with you.
4. Jack to erase some of the whispers about his attitude.
If those above are done, both sides will have an outcome that works for them. Acting like a petulant child won't help.
There may be good reasons he's mad at the org, BUT they are clear they need to get a certain value. He needs to do whatever he can to help them get that IF he wants to play anywhere else for the next 5 years. |

As long as those contracts are only about 2 MAYBE 3 years, they are in position to do that.
But I would think that would only increase the return you get for Eichel because they'd be getting two important assets from Buffalo right now:
1. Jack Eichel
2. Salary Cap
Salary Cap is a much cheaper asset for sure, but I don't see how adding back bad contracts does not make sure they're getting even more.
KA has a base value for Eichel he wants alone, maybe he does have to take a bad contract back to make the money work, but I'd be looking for an additional mid to late round pick as that is pretty much the going rate for trading for cap space. |
